Conteúdo do exercício
Caro(a) Aluno(a),



Chegamos à Avaliação denominada Atividade Contextualizada!



Espero que você aproveite cada informação disponibilizada em nosso material didático e não esqueça de que o seu Tutor também pode auxiliar você na avaliação, caso tenha dúvida, procure-o no Fale com o Tutor.



Lembre-se: sua opinião precisa ser baseada e justificada, respaldando cientificamente seu conhecimento e pensamento, pois não serão aceitos trechos e/ou postagens sem as devidas referências.



Então vamos lá?



O campo da programação web abrange uma ampla gama de tecnologias e melhores práticas para o desenvolvimento de aplicações web interativas e eficientes. O profissional que possui a habilidade em desenvolvimento web é bastante valorizado no mercado, pois a base da criação de sites e aplicativos estão na vanguarda da comunicação e dos negócios na era digital. Hoje em dia, praticamente qualquer empresa quer marcar presença na internet - desde as atividades em redes sociais a compras online. Além disso, essa tecnologia é tão versátil e benéfica que atende a empresas de todos os portes, desde pequenas e médias até grandes corporações. Profissionais de programação web desempenham um papel fundamental na criação de experiências online inovadoras e acessíveis.

Nessa perspectiva, o profissional à medida que ganha experiência, pode se especializar em front-end (interface do usuário), back-end (lógica de servidor), desenvolvimento full-stack (ambos) ou em áreas como segurança, acessibilidade ou otimização de desempenho.

As bases para a programação web incluem uma série de conceitos, linguagens e tecnologias essenciais para entender e desenvolver sites e aplicativos da web. Aqui estão as bases fundamentais para a programação web:



• HTML (HyperText Markup Language): trata-se de uma linguagem de marcação usada para criar a estrutura e o conteúdo de uma página da web, são elementos principais: cabeçalhos, parágrafos, links, imagens e formulários.



• CSS (Cascading Style Sheets): é usado para estilizar e formatar o conteúdo HTML. Com o CSS, pode-se definir cores, fontes, layouts e estilos visuais para criar a aparência desejada do site.



• JavaScript: é uma linguagem de programação usada para adicionar interatividade e funcionalidade a uma página da web. Com o JavaScript, você pode criar animações, validar formulários, entre outros.



• HTTP (Hypertext Transfer Protocol) e Protocolo de Comunicação: são essenciais para entender como os navegadores e servidores se comunicam. Isso inclui solicitações (requests) e respostas (responses) para carregar páginas da web.



• Servidor Web: é um software que hospeda e entrega páginas da web para os navegadores.



• Bancos de Dados: são usados para armazenar e gerenciar dados em sites dinâmicos.



Após realizar suas reflexões, elabore um pequeno texto, contendo o máximo de 20 a 30 linhas, expondo sua argumentação, acerca do solicitado.

Resposta :

Outras perguntas